The learning and development program

ALTUM Health has a learning and development program. It is aligned to the business needs and objectives which are important for employee engagement and to achieve client outcome and business results.

It is available to all employees. Activities must be tied to leads, timelines and goals. Relevant, self-directed learning is encouraged

There are two levels of learning and development:

1- Job required: For supporting fundamental skills and competency development

2- Job enhancement and personal development

Methods:

  •  Webinar: One-hour live presentation (including a facilitated 10-15-minute question and answer period) ideal for sharing knowledge and resources on a particular topic, as well as answering live questions.
  • Self-study module: One to four modules with 30 to 90 minutes of content including a prerecorded presentation with engaging features for learning (e.g., videos, quizzes, case studies).
  • Online course: 4-12 weeks worth of content delivered in online format for more in-depth exploration of topics, group discussion and peer feedback, reflection and hands-on activities that can be developed through simulations.
  • Workshop: One- to three-day live in-person events that involve presentations, demonstrations, group discussions and hands-on activities.
  • Hybrid workshop: Workshop with webinar or self-study module for preparation or follow up.

There is a program in which clinician train other clinicians. The goals of this program are:

  • Educating Future Generation of Clinicians
  • Training in LEAN methodology
  • Building Clinical & Admin Competency
  • Implemented Advanced practitioner training & MOC

Examples of learning and development programs offered by ALTUM Health are:

  • New employee training modules
  • WSIB specialty programs
  • Clinical training

ALTUM Health has decided to use online learning for some of its programs. An online platform named Embodia has been used for this purpose. Designed as a Physiotherapy Online Continuing Education, Embodia’s goal had been providing an Online continuing education for physiotherapists who are interested in learning on their own time and schedule. By the way, it has many similarities with other online learning platforms and can be used for all kinds of online courses that ALTUM Health is offering.
